PRO TIPS:

  1. Grab some airpods for the Rick Steve’s audio tour
  2. Use hop on hop off buses – go around Moulin Rouge / Opera area at night
  3. Go to the Arc de Triomphe around sunset for incredible views of the Eiffel Tower
  4. All city pass is worth purchasing depending on what activities you will be doing
  5. Take boat tour down the Siene
  6. Book tickets in advance for the Eiffel Tower
  7. The Eiffel Tower sparkles every hour on the hour starting from sundown
